What's Senas like for family-friendly holidays?
The destination of Senas is a great choice if you've been thinking about a holiday with your children. The mountain views here makes this a great choice for a family holiday. Arrange a flight into Avignon (AVN-Caumont), which is located 14.2 mi (22.9 km) from the city centre.
When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Senas?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Senas is 714 mm.
What's there to see and do with your family in Senas?
While you and your family are visiting Senas, you may want to explore some child-friendly attractions such as Luberon Regional Park, Zoo Barben and Le Village Des Marques.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as SCAD Lacoste and Alpilles Regional Natural Park.
What's the best way for us to get around Senas?
If you want to explore the larger area, hop aboard a train at Senas Station. Senas might not have very many public transport options, so consider renting a car to explore more.
